Overview
Eptus Tablets contain Eplerenone 50 mg, a selective aldosterone receptor antagonist used to manage high blood pressure (hypertension) and heart failure post-myocardial infarction. Eplerenone helps reduce fluid retention and prevents the harmful effects of aldosterone on the heart and kidneys, thereby improving cardiovascular outcomes.

How to Use
Take Eptus Tablets orally with or without food, preferably at the same time each day. Swallow the tablet whole with water. Follow your healthcare provider’s dosage instructions carefully.
Dosage Information
The typical dose is 50 mg once daily, which may be adjusted based on patient response and medical condition. Dosage range usually varies from 25 mg to 50 mg daily. Always follow your doctor’s prescription.
Safety Information
-
Use under medical supervision, especially if you have kidney impairment or elevated potassium levels.
-
Inform your healthcare provider about all medications to prevent interactions.
-
Not recommended during pregnancy or breastfeeding unless advised otherwise.
-
Regular monitoring of serum potassium and kidney function is essential.
-
Do not discontinue medication abruptly without consulting your healthcare provider.
Possible Side Effects
Common side effects include dizziness, headache, increased potassium levels, and fatigue. Serious side effects may include hyperkalemia (high potassium), kidney dysfunction, or allergic reactions. Seek immediate medical attention if severe symptoms occur.
Storage Instructions
Store in a cool, dry place away from sunlight and moisture. Keep the container tightly closed and out of reach of children.
FAQs
Q: Can Eptus 50 mg be taken with food?
A: Yes, it can be taken with or without food.
Q: How soon will it help lower blood pressure?
A: Blood pressure reduction may be noticeable within a few weeks.
Q: What if I miss a dose?
A: Take the missed dose as soon as possible unless it is near the next dose. Do not double dose.
Q: Does Eptus increase potassium levels?
A: Yes, potassium levels should be regularly monitored during treatment.
